Shengyu Yang is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Oncology and Immunology. According to data from OpenAlex, Shengyu Yang has authored 58 papers receiving a total of 2.7k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 26 papers in Molecular Biology, 25 papers in Oncology and 13 papers in Immunology. Recurrent topics in Shengyu Yang’s work include Pancreatic and Hepatic Oncology Research (10 papers), Cancer, Hypoxia, and Metabolism (9 papers) and Cancer Cells and Metastasis (8 papers). Shengyu Yang is often cited by papers focused on Pancreatic and Hepatic Oncology Research (10 papers), Cancer, Hypoxia, and Metabolism (9 papers) and Cancer Cells and Metastasis (8 papers). Shengyu Yang collaborates with scholars based in United States, China and Taiwan. Shengyu Yang's co-authors include Jihui Hao, Xiuchao Wang, Chongbiao Huang, Tiansuo Zhao, Lin Chen, J. Jillian Zhang, Jean Jakoncic, Xin-Yun Huang, Shengchen Lin and He Ren and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ature, Chemical Society Reviews and Journal of Biological Chemistry.
